Tekken 7 Update 1.10 Fixes Input Lag, View the Patch Notes

Tekken 7 update 1.10 is now available to download on PlayStation 4, Xbox One, and PC. While it’s a smaller update, it does include one major fix that eliminates the input lag issues on console. In addition, it also increases “overall game stability.”

Check out the complete Tekken 7 update 1.10 patch notes below:

 

  • Reduced Input Delay on PS4 & XB1: improved controller input responsiveness.
  • Improvement of overall game stability on PS4, XB1 and PC: increased game performance stability during battle and character customization.
